How to Link Your SBI RuPay Credit Card to UPI

If you possess a State Bank of India (SBI) RuPay credit card and wish to engage in seamless and secure digital transactions, linking it to Unified Payments Interface (UPI) emerges as the optimal solution. This guide caters to novices aiming to elevate their digital banking experience with ease.

Step 1: Download the UPI-enabled App

Before embarking on the linking process, ensure the presence of a UPI-enabled app on your smartphone. Popular choices encompass Google Pay, PhonePe, or any other UPI-supported app accessible on your app store.

Step 2: Set Up Your Account by Opening the UPI Application

To establish your UPI account, utilize the UPI app and adhere to on-screen directives. This typically involves entering your mobile number, validating it with an OTP (One-Time Password), and configuring a UPI PIN for added security.

Step 3: Set Up “Add a Bank Account” Option

Once your UPI account is configured, open the app and opt for “Add a Bank Account” or an equivalent option. This marks the space where your SBI RuPay credit card will seamlessly link.

Step 4: Select State Bank of India as Your Bank

Within the roster of available banks, locate and designate “State Bank of India” as your bank. This step ensures seamless recognition of your SBI RuPay credit card by the UPI app.

Step 5: Link Your SBI RuPay Credit Card

After designating SBI, the app prompts you to link your bank account. Here, choose the option pertaining to credit cards or additional services. Subsequently, you may be prompted to input your SBI RuPay credit card details, including the card number and expiry date.

Step 6: Verify Your Identity

To fortify security, the app may necessitate additional verification, such as an OTP sent to your registered phone number or alternative authentication methods. Input the required details to advance.

Step 7: Set a UPI PIN for Your SBI RuPay Credit Card

As an augmented security measure, establish a UPI PIN specific to your SBI RuPay credit card. This PIN becomes instrumental whenever you engage in UPI transactions, ensuring exclusive authorization for payments from your linked credit card.

Step 8: Complete the Process

Upon entering all requisite details and configuring your UPI PIN, the app affirms the successful linking of your SBI RuPay credit card. Your credit card should now be visibly listed among your linked accounts within the UPI app.

Step 9: Test Your Linked SBI RuPay Credit Card

To verify the accuracy of your setup, conduct a small transaction using your linked SBI RuPay credit card through the UPI app. This can be a straightforward fund transfer or a modest payment to a UPI ID. Confirm that the transaction transpires seamlessly.

Tips for a Smooth Linking Process:

Ensure Stable Internet Connection: A robust and uninterrupted Internet connection is pivotal throughout the linking process to evade disruptions.

Keep SBI RuPay Credit Card Details Handy: Prior to initiation, have your SBI RuPay credit card details, including the card number and expiry date, easily accessible.

Follow On-Screen Instructions Carefully: UPI apps furnish step-by-step instructions during the linking process. Adhere to them meticulously to sidestep errors.

Check for App Updates: Confirm that both your UPI app and SBI app are updated to their latest versions to avert compatibility issues.
